Business Hours & Closures
Set Your Operating Schedule – Business hours define when your entire business is open for bookings. These store-wide settings apply to all staff members and control when customers can book appointments through your system.
📍 Accessing Hours & Closures
To configure your business hours, click on Settings in the left sidebar menu, then select the Hours & Closures tab.
1 Setting Business Hours

Business hours management with intelligent conflict detection
Configuring Your Weekly Schedule
Set your operating hours for each day of the week:
- Week Overview – See all seven days at a glance with current operating hours
- Toggle Days On/Off – Use the “Active” toggle to mark each day as open or closed
- Set Opening Time – Choose when your business opens each day
- Set Closing Time – Choose when your business closes each day
- Closed All Day Option – Check this box for days you don’t operate
🔄 How It Works
Change hours for any day and the system will check for conflicts in real-time. If bookings exist that would fall outside new hours, you can schedule the change for a future date. The new hours will automatically take effect on that date.
Intelligent Conflict Detection
The system automatically checks for scheduling conflicts:
- Real-Time Validation – When you change business hours, the system immediately checks if any existing bookings would be affected
- Conflict Warnings – If bookings exist outside your new hours, you’ll see a clear warning message
- Schedule Changes – You can schedule hour changes for a future date to avoid conflicts
- Automatic Application – Scheduled changes automatically apply on the specified date
⚠️ Important
Business hours are the master schedule for your entire booking system. Individual staff members cannot be available outside of these hours, even if their personal schedule allows it.
2 Holiday Hours & Special Closures
Manage days when your business is closed or has special hours for holidays, maintenance, or other events.
Adding a Closure
- Scroll to the “Holiday Hours & Special Closures” section
- Click on the Date picker and select the closure date
- Check the Closed checkbox to mark it as a full-day closure
- Click Add Holiday/Closure button
- The date will appear in your closure list
Managing Closures
- View All Closures – See a list of all scheduled closure dates
- Remove Closures – Click the “Remove” button next to any closure if plans change
- Multiple Closures – Add as many closure dates as needed
Common Uses for Closures
- Public holidays (Christmas, New Year’s, etc.)
- Staff training days
- Business maintenance or renovations
- Owner vacation days
- Special events affecting the whole business
- Emergency closures
📅 Plan Ahead
Add holiday closures well in advance to prevent customers from booking on days you won’t be open. This is especially important for major holidays when customers may try to book weeks ahead.
3 Business Hours vs. Staff Hours
Understanding the difference between business hours and individual staff hours:
Business Hours (This Page)
- Scope: Apply to the entire business and all staff members
- Purpose: Define when the business operates
- Effect: No staff can be available outside these hours
- Closures: Affect all staff simultaneously
Staff Hours (Manage Staff Page)
- Scope: Apply to individual staff members
- Purpose: Define when each staff member works
- Effect: Must fall within business hours
- Flexibility: Each staff member can have different schedules
Example Scenario
Business Hours: Monday-Friday, 9:00 AM – 6:00 PM
Staff Member Sarah: Monday-Thursday, 10:00 AM – 5:00 PM
Staff Member John: Monday-Friday, 9:00 AM – 3:00 PM
Result: Customers can book with Sarah between 10 AM-5 PM Mon-Thu, and with John between 9 AM-3 PM Mon-Fri. Both schedules fit within business hours.
